This testing machine is mainly used to test samples of electrical materials, adhesive products, solar photovoltaic modules, etc.: precision mechanical tests such as stretching, shearing, peeling, and tearing. At the same time, testing and data processing can be carried out according to GB, ISO, JIS, ASTM, DIN and various standards provided by users.
This testing machine is widely used in rubber products, plastic products, wires and cables, electronic products, textile materials, clothing products and other industries, institutions of higher learning, scientific research laboratories, commodity inspection arbitration, technical supervision and other departments.
Technical specifications of ADICO large-tonnage universal material testing machine:
1. Test force selection: 0-10000kg;
2. Accuracy level: better than 0.5 level;
3. Load measurement range: 0.2%—100% FS;
4. Allowable error limit of test force indication: within ±0.5% of indicated value;
5. Test force display resolution: 1/±500000 of the maximum test force;
6. Sampling frequency: 400 times/second;
7. Deformation measurement range: 0.2%—100% FS;
8. Deformation indication error limit: within ±0.50% of indication;
9. Deformation resolution: 0.001mm
10. Error limit of displacement indication: within ±0.5% of indication;
11. Displacement resolution: 0.001mm
12. Adjustment range of displacement speed: 1.0-500mm/min
13. Displacement rate control accuracy: within ±1.0% of the set value;
14. Effective test width: 400mm
15. Effective stretching space distance: 600mm
16. External dimensions of the host (length×width×height): 600×400×1250 (mm)
17. Power supply: single-phase 220V 50Hz 500W;
18. Machine weight: about 200kg;
